What do you mean by literary tycoon?
1 answer
2024-09-12 22:10

A literary tycoon was a figurative term that was usually used to describe a person who had outstanding achievements in a certain field. This term was usually used to refer to those who had a wide and profound influence in the field of literature, such as shakespeare, homer, du fu, lu xun, etc. Their works were widely read and had a profound impact on the development and evolution of literature. In the field of novels, literary masters usually referred to those who had outstanding achievements in novel creation, literary criticism, literary history research, etc., such as Hugo, Dickens, Tolstoy, Maugham, Ernest Hemmingway, Faulkner, etc. These novelists 'literary works and literary achievements were widely recognized and respected, which had a profound impact on the development and evolution of novels.

What do literary elements mean in a story?

2 answers
2024-09-28 15:05

Literary elements are the components that make up a story. They include things like characters, plot, setting, theme, and style.
